When I play Paper Mario TTYD Pal on Wii U through Nintendont the game has graphical errors both when selecting 60Hz or 50Hz.

so the graphical errors is the screen pushed to the side abit? that isnt a graphical error ...

im guessing you have settings namely width,force widescreen or center position selected on nintendont, those are hacks and for some games instead of filling the screen they just move the screen, take a picture of your nintendont settings. or disable anything that isnt memory card emulation.

well your forcing a pal game to ntsc video, not all pal games can be forced to ntsc, some work better than others, does your tv not support pal signals? you should just try with video on auto if your tv supports pal signals.

if you use gamepad then there is no need to force videomodes, wiiu gamepad is compatible with all videomodes of wii/wiiu so any pal signal will works just fine, just switch videomode to auto and disable the patch pal 50 option.
